Minors, Microprograms, and Certificates

Minors and microprograms are a good way to explore outside of your main program and acquire solid knowledge in another discipline. All minors and microprograms must be taken in addition to a main program, and are generally added in your second year of study.

Certificates, on the other hand, can be taken on their own, and are a good way to acquire new skills without registering in a full-time program.
